Show the backboards and a few shots of the dovetails, any, ANY marks etc. Could be American from Grand Rapids, MI. Different companies did a few French lines like this. About 1920, possibly a bit older. It's not period French furniture.

I would guess this to be made in France in the 1920s or 1930s, hard to tell from the photos. The bedroom set is in the Louis XVI style with marquetry details.
